HomeSnap Maker Raises $3.5M For Real Estate App That Uses iPhone Camera To “See” The House In Front Of You

HomeSnap-iphone

Sawbuck Realty, the makers of that clever mobile app called HomeSnap, which lets users access MLS and public record data just by taking a picture of any U.S. home, has closed on $3.5 million in additional funding, the company announced today. The financing comes from Revolution Ventures and Washington D.C. real estate investor Robert Stewart.

HomeSnap Is Not A Boring Real Estate App

HomeSnap-iphone

Sawbuck Realty, an online real estate broker, has just launched a new app called HomeSnap which lets you discover information about any home nationwide just by taking a photo of it.
